The cheapest way to get from South Bend to Logansport is to drive which costs $12 - $19 and takes 1h 25m.
The fastest way to get from South Bend to Logansport is to drive which takes 1h 25m and costs $12 - $19.
The distance between South Bend and Logansport is 83 miles. The road distance is 69.2 miles.
The best way to get from South Bend to Logansport without a car is to bus and taxi which takes 1h 40m and costs $30 - $50.
It takes approximately 1h 40m to get from South Bend to Logansport,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between South Bend to Logansport is 69 miles. It takes approximately 1h 25m to drive from South Bend to Logansport.

There is no direct connection from South Bend to Logansport. However, you can take the bus to Peru then take the taxi to Logansport. Alternatively, you can drive from South Bend to Logansport in around 1h 25m.
